Understanding the Core Elements of a Crime Family Narrative
Creating an engaging graphic novel centered on mob life requires a deep understanding of the dynamics that define crime families. These stories thrive on complex relationships, loyalty struggles, and power plays. Crafting a Compelling Visual Style That Enhances Storytelling
Since graphic novels rely heavily on imagery, selecting the right visual style is crucial. Noir-inspired aesthetics often fit perfectly with crime-related themes, using stark contrasts, shadows, and moody palettes to evoke suspense and danger. The atmosphere created through artwork plays a large role in immersing readers in the underworld environment, making the narrative feel both authentic and gripping.
Developing Plotlines That Balance Action and Character Growth
Successful crime stories go beyond shootouts and heists—they explore the psychological and emotional toll on characters. While crafting your narrative arcs, balance scenes of high tension with moments that reveal personal struggles or moral dilemmas. Include subplots that test loyalties within the crime family, showcasing how external pressures shape alliances and betrayals. This layered storytelling approach keeps readers engaged, offering more than just surface-level thrills but a nuanced exploration of power and consequence.
